Four-Day Workshop for Early Career Researchers

The Bahrain Early Career Researchers Workshop, a focused 4-day event, brought together emerging academics from various institutions to sharpen their research capabilities and expand their professional horizons.

Held at Applied Science University (ASU) in Bahrain, the workshop featured interactive sessions designed to bridge key skill gaps in research practice. Participants benefited from expert-led training on:

  • Improving academic writing quality
  • Adopting agile research management approaches
  • Leveraging digital tools for analysis
  • Developing strong funding proposals

This collaborative event fostered knowledge sharing, practical learning, and a supportive environment for early career researchers to thrive in their academic journey.

Workshop Days

Day 1: Quality Criteria for Good Academic Writing

Focused on enhancing the quality of academic writing by addressing three critical criteria: Originality, Significance, and Rigour.

Day 2: The Agile Researcher

Explored agile project management tools in academic research, highlighting the use of the Work Breakdown Structure (WBS), Kanban boards, and Sprints.
